A variable frequency drive (VFD) is a type of motor controller that drives an electric motor by varying the frequency and voltage of its power supply. The VFD also has the capacity to control the ramp-up and ramp-down of the motor during start or stop, respectively.

A variable frequency drive (VFD) or inverter is a controller for electric motors commonly used in electromechanical drive systems. Its main function is to regulate the speed and torque of the induction motor , varying the motor input frequency and controlling the corresponding voltage or current changes depending on the topology.

2025年3月11日 · Applications. There are many advantages to using a VFD in a manufacturing environment. For example, say one were to connect a VFD to an AC motor to drive a conveyor belt. The speed of the belt could be adjusted as needed through the VFD to match production in other parts of the facility.
